数值分析期末复习要点总结.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
* 故, 简单迭代法 27 * Newton 法 基本思想 将非线性方程线性化 设 xk 是 f (x)=0 的近似根,将 f(x) 在 xk 处 Taylor 展开 令: 条件: f’(x) ? 0 * Newton 法 x y x* xk xk+1 * 因为 得牛顿迭代公式为 例7 用Newton法求方程 在(1,2)的根,取初值 [解] Newton法与弦截法 根据 Newton迭代 故在[1,2]内方程有唯一实根 取初值 得 22 * 代入初值得 Newton法与弦截法 故取 23 * k = 0, 1, 2, . . . 迭代函数 牛顿法至少二阶局部收敛 * 例:用 Newton 法求 f(x) = x2 – C=0 的正根, 并验证这一方法的二阶收敛性 解: 对任意 x00, 总有 |q|1, 即牛顿法收敛 * 二阶收敛 关于二次收敛性,事实上 * * * 常微分方程数值解法 (9-2) 公式(9-2)称为显式欧拉公式. Euler法的局部截断误差也可表示为 Euler方法是一阶方法. 第九章 常微分方程数值解法 30 * (9-9) 这就是求解初值问题式(9-1)的梯形公式. 梯形公式(9-9)的局部截断误差为 常微分方程数值解法 故梯形公式为二阶方法. 31 * 常微分方程数值解法 一般地,RK方法设近似公式为 (9-13) 其中 都是参数, 确定它们的原则是使近似 公式在  处的Taylor展开式与  在  处的 Taylor展开式的前面的项尽可能多地重合,这样就使近 似公式有尽可能高的精度。 32 * 常微分方程数值解法 这就是改进Euler公式,它是一种二阶龙格-库塔公式。 33 * 常微分方程数值解法 (9-11) 式(9-11)称为由Euler公式和梯形公式得到的预测— 校正系统,也叫改进Euler法,它是显式单步法。 预测 校正 改进Euler法的局部截断误差为 故它是二阶方法。 34 * 例1用欧拉法求初值问题 当h = 0.02时在区间[0, 0.10]上的数值解。 解 把 代入欧拉法计算公式。就得 具体计算结果如下表: n xn yn y(xn) ?n = y(xn) - yn 0 0 1.0000 1.0000 0 1 0.02 0.9820 0.9825 0.0005 2 0.04 0.9650 0.9660 0.0005 3 0.06 0.9489 0.9503 0.0014 4 0.08 0.9336 0.9354 0.0018 5 0.10 0.9192 0.923 0.0021 * 常微分方程数值解法 例 用改进的Euler法求初值问题 的数值解, 取 . 解 改进的Euler公式为 所以 35 * 常微分方程数值解法 将 代入上式得 将 代入上式得 将 代入上式得 36 * 常微分方程数值解法 例12 用二阶方程初值问题 化为一阶方程组初值问题,并写出欧拉方法求解的 解 令 计算公式. 可得 计算公式为 41 * 定义     若某算法对于任意固定的 x = xi = x0 + i h,当 h?0 ( 同时 i ? ?) 时有 yi ? y( xi ),则称该算法是收敛的。 定义    若某算法在计算过程中任一步产生的误差在以后的计算中都逐步衰减,则称该算法是绝对稳定的 一般分析时为简单起见,只考虑试验方程 常数,可以是复数 当步长取为 h 时,将某算法应用于上式,并假设只在初值产生误差 ,则若此误差以后逐步衰减,就称该算法相对于 绝对稳定, 的全体构成绝对稳定区域。 h l h = h * 例4.3 对初值问题 证明用梯形公式求得的近似解为 , 并证明当步长h?0时,yn 收敛于精确解 证明: 解初值问题的梯形公式为: ∵ ∴ 整理成显式 反复迭代,得到: * 整理成显式 反复迭代,得到: ∵ ∴ 例 对初值问题 证明用梯形公式求得的近似解为 , 并证明当步长h?0时,yn 收敛于精确解 * 由于 ,有: ∴ 证毕 * 例:考察显式欧拉法 由此可见,要保证初始误差?0 以后逐步衰减, 必须满足: 0 - 1 - 2 例:考察隐式欧拉法 可见绝对稳定区域为: 2 1 0 注:一般来说,隐式欧拉法的绝对稳定性比同阶的显式法的好。 * 6.证明求解初值问题 的如下单步法 是二阶方法。 谢 谢! 放映结束 感谢各位批评指导! 让我们共

文档评论(0)

文档分享 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档